Red

2013 Omina Romana Lazio

Cabernet Franc more

4/26/2024 - Odedis.Wine.reviews Likes this wine: 91 points

Dark ruby in color with a wide reddish/ brick rim.

Strong spicy nose with light cedar, tobacco, chocolates and licorice.

Medium plus in body with medium acidity.

Dry on the palate with black plums, black currants, coffee, light cedar, cola, light earth, herbs, tobacco leaf and dried meat.

Tangy finish with soft tannins and tangy raspberries.

This is a very tasty Cabernet Franc from Lazio, Italy. An interesting wine that feels more like a Right Bank Bordeaux.

This 11 year old is tasty right out of the bottle, and better with airtime. Rich, yet elegant.

Would be nice to revisit it again in 3 years.

A good quality wine. Good by itself or with food.

100% Cabernet Franc grapes were aged in oak barrels for 20 months.

14% alcohol by volume.

91 points.

Red

2015 Stefano Chioccioli Altore Toscana IGT

Sangiovese Blend, Sangiovese more

4/26/2024 - shemmy wrote: NR

Chioccioli is run by brothers Niccolò and Enrico and their sister Ginevra. Their father is a respected oenologist and agronomist who consults for the siblings. They grew up in Greve in Chianti and have long held a passion for creating terroir specific examples of the sangiovese grape. The siblings think of their vines as members of the family.

The vineyards are surrounded by woods of great biodiversity that help keep the vineyards cool and sheltered and contribute to the vitality of the soils. The vines are cared for using only organic processes. A green harvest is carried out each season to concentrate the remaining bunches’ flavors. When the grapes reach the perfect balance, they are harvested parcel by parcel. The grapes are brought in in small boxes to the cellar where they are carefully sorted and then cooled overnight to preserve freshness before being crushed the next morning to begin the honing of their bespoke Chiantis.

This wine is the perfect complement of cabernet sauvignon with sangiovese. After the green harvest, the fully ripened bunches are harvested into small boxes, then cooled overnight. They are meticulously sorted and then fermented in barriques with vinification integrale. The wine ages for two years in oak barrels before another year in bottle. The deep plummy darkness of the cabernet is balanced with waves of bright cacao dusted red cherries. Mint and thyme and leather color the edges of all of the flavors. This wine is a perfect meeting of classicism and modernity.

Red

2018 Isola delle Falcole Chianti Classico Gran Selezione

Chianti Classico DOCG Sangiovese more

4/26/2024 - shemmy wrote: NR

We love an old, pedigreed wine producer. We also love a young, brilliant-eyed producer, bringing a fresh new perspective to a storied wine region. Isole delle Falcole is the latter.

The venture of three friends, Emanuele, Alessandro and Niccolò, Isola delle Falco works a total of four hectares in the heart of Chianti Classico, between Panzano and Montefioralle. Each of their parcels is considered grand-cru-level, at altitudes between 400 and 520 meters above sea level, planted with vines between 35 and 70 years old. They work a range of microclimates, prioritizing maturity, freshness, and finesse in their grapes. They own 14 additional hectares, four more of which will be converted to vineyards by 2030. Emmanuele, Alessandro, and Niccolò don’t spend much time talking about themselves, because they want the land itself to be the protagonist in the story.
2018 was on the warmer side, resulting in ripe bing cherry flavors, black currant, and baking spice, while maintaining mouth-puckering acidity. The wine spent 30 months in large wooden French and Slovenian casks, with 8 more months in bottle before being released.

Red - Sweet/Dessert

2017 Roccolo Grassi Recioto della Valpolicella

Corvina Blend, Corvina more

4/26/2024 - William Kelley Likes this wine: NR

Grassi's 2017 Recioto della Valpolicella is a beautiful wine, wafting from the glass with aromas of licorice, orange confit, roasted berries and vine smoke, followed by a medium to full-bodied, deep and fleshy palate with a sweet core that's tempered by elegantly mordant structuring tannins to render this cohesive and harmonious, concluding with a perfectly balanced finish.
